IVV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

2,681 of the 6,222 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Core S&P 500 ETF (IVV)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$214B — up 12% from $191B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 318 funds opened new IVV positions and 80 closed out — a net gain of 238 holders — while 1,115 added to existing stakes and 941 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$2.03B.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$6.32B.
